Deciphering Variance in the Context of Slot Machines
Variance, also known as volatility in the gambling industry, describes the level of risk associated with a particular slot game. It influences how often wins occur, the size of those wins, and the overall bankroll management strategy players should adopt.
In high-variance slots, such as the classic Eye of Horus title, players typically experience infrequent but substantial payouts. Conversely, low-variance slots offer more regular, smaller wins, catering to a different playing style and risk appetite.

Technical Breakdown: High-Variance Slot Mechanics
Consider the underlying mathematics that define variance. Essentially, the game’s payout distribution, return-to-player (RTP), and bonus feature triggers all contribute to the variance level. Here’s a simplified model:
| Factor | Impact on Variance |
|---|---|
| Bonus Feature Frequency | Lower frequency increases variance |
| Maximum Payout | Higher potential payouts elevate variance |
| Payline Structure | Few paylines with big wins raise variance |
| Game Design | Risk-reward balancing influences variance level |
In the case of Eye of Horus, the game is characterized by a moderate to high variance, offering relatively infrequent but substantial wins, especially when players land the bonus features or free spins. This variance contributes to its popularity among thrill-seekers and high-stakes players.
